SPT Split Tube Sampler

For carrying out the Standard Penetration Test. Manufactured to BS 1377: Part 9: 1990, consisting of Top Adaptor, pair of Split Spoons, and open SPT Shoe. As an option the sampler may also be provided with a Basket Retainer made from plastic or steel.

The Top Adaptor contains a ball valve held in place by a threaded brass seat. This is to prevent the sample being washed away when the sampler is withdrawn from the borehole. The thread connection on the top adaptor depends on the type of drill rods being used to drive the sampler, but is most frequently 1.1/2" B.S. Whitworth, BW Rod or AW Rod.

The split spoon is manufactured from high tensile alloy steel tube. The shoe is case hardened and tempered to give optimum wear resistance.

Also available for tests in gravels and gravelly sand is a Solid Nose Cone, which has a 60° point replaces the standard open SPT shoe. Alternatively, the entire Split Tube Sampler may be replaced with the Long Solid Rod, also with a soild point. The results of tests using these tools should be reported with the preface SPT(C).

The standard Split Tube Sampler is 2" (50.8 mm) OD x 1.3/8" (34.9 mm )ID x 24" (610 mm) long. Other diameters are available to order. Split tube samplers can also be supplied in Stainless Steel or with Clear Plastic Liners.
